Project: All-Terrain Mobility Vehicle // Status: GEOMETRY VALIDATION

Mission Objective

To provide absolute independence for those with mobility challenges, enabling them to traverse multi-story buildings and rough outdoor terrain manually, without any reliance on electric power or external charging.

Engineering Scope

STAIR RISER 20 CM
MAX WIDTH < 80 CM
TARGET LOAD 75 KG
DRIVE TYPE MANUAL ROWING
FRAME ALUMINUM 6061-T6

Step-by-Step Implementation

Geometric Validation COMPLETED

Verified Tri-Star arm lengths (150mm) and wheel diameters (300mm) against 20cm stair risings with a 100mm safety margin.

CAD Drafting & BOM COMPLETED

Detailed technical schematics and Bill of Materials finalized for the $650$mm silent rowing linkage and $12$" pneumatic drive system.

3

Cardboard Prototype (1:4)

Physical verification of the Tri-Star stepping logic and Rowing Leverage ratios using laser-cut cardboard components.
